I too as an Australian have noticed this in the past. Looking at the
Ubiquity source the code that produces these locations is in:
ubiquity/tz.py

It processes the locations from the file /usr/share/zoneinfo/zone.tab
which is from the Unix tz database and looking at the file on my 13.04
system it seems the Sydney location is pretty much correct: -33.52
+151.13. Its possible that the code that parses the locations isn't
working correctly. Are there other citys around the world in the wrong
place or is it just Sydney?

Bug description:
  In ubiquity, the timezone marker points at least 500km away from
  sydney. it seems to be in the ACT(canberra) rather than new south
  wales.

  This occurs both with auto-locate and when manually selecting the
  location.
